Sobre Halong
Halong Bay is a UNESCO World Heritage Site in northeastern Vietnam, renowned for its thousands of limestone karst islands rising dramatically from emerald-green waters. Cruise ships typically anchor near the bay, and passengers board smaller junk boats or tender vessels to explore caves such as Hang Sung Sot and kayak among the karsts. The scenery is among the most iconic in all of Southeast Asia.
